Output 52689ae9a17e2ee61c74730883ad3d0bb34ece21da73757e5c9a4541c61a3bce:0

value
28666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 26450a45b004e68c393c7f9c650b70bd8a6edc737f40562e91f67c3953a846c2
address
bc1pyezs53dsqnngcwfu07wx2zmshk9xahrn0aq9vt537e7rj5aggmpqxe5tdf
transaction
52689ae9a17e2ee61c74730883ad3d0bb34ece21da73757e5c9a4541c61a3bce